Compact Loader Land Demolition: Improving Performance & Methods
Leveraging a skid steer for land grading offers a significant advantage in efficiency compared to conventional methods. This versatile machines, like Bobcat loaders, excel at removing brush, stumps , and undergrowth, allowing for rapid site access. Common techniques involve the use of implements such as grapple buckets for grabbing and pulling, chipping heads for reducing vegetation to usable sizes, and cold planers for dealing with larger obstacles. Skilled operation and attachment selection are vital for operator protection and maximizing the loader's potential.
How Much Does Land Clearing Really Cost?
Determining a price of land preparation can be surprisingly difficult. Several elements influence the final figure, such as the area of a lot, the density of vegetation β from little brush to big trees β and the kind of clearing needed, if itβs just undergrowth removal or involves stump elimination and debris disposal. You can anticipate prices varying from roughly $3 to $15 per square section for basic shrubs preparation, but full site clearing, featuring timber removal and tree elimination, can quickly amount $10 to $30 or higher each square foot.
Mini Excavator Land Clearing: A Powerful Alternative
Clearing terrain for building projects can be a difficult task. Traditionally, big equipment like bulldozers and tractors were the standard solution, but there's a rising trend towards utilizing compact excavators as a practical alternative. These pieces of equipment offer a significant advantage in areas with tight access, uneven ground, or where reduced ground disturbance is needed. They can effortlessly maneuver around impediments and are appropriate for removing brush , small trees , and rubble . Furthermore, their reduced size often translates to reduced transportation expenses and minimal site preparation.

Selecting the Appropriate Tools: Bobcat vs. Mini Excavator for Land Clearing
When tackling a land clearing project, the decision of machinery is vital. Both a Bobcat and a compact excavator offer upsides, but they perform in different areas. Bobcats are usually better for handling material and smoothing ground, especially when encountering large quantities of brush. However, a compact excavator outperforms at digging stumps, cutting rock, and forming uneven terrain.
Area Clearing Optimal Practices : Well-being & Natural Aspects
Effective area clearing requires a thorough approach prioritizing staff well-being and minimizing natural disruption. Prior to , a thorough assessment of the area is crucial, locating potential dangers , including buried utilities, endangered species habitats, and archaeological artifacts . Careful adherence to local regulations is essential , often requiring permits and erosion control measures . To protect environmental resources, consider careful felling of vegetation and using green processes like mulching as opposed to widespread obliteration. Moreover , implementing particulate control methods and properly disposing of debris are important aspects of responsible land clearing.
